1. hmm
2. does already exist throught batch-files and also throught ; seperated recipients text
3. The access to SIM-Contacts is on Android-Phones often diffrent or missing so i will not integrate this
4. 100% identical contacts are very seldom, and to match "similar" contacts without issues is very difficult
5. exists already
6. Please search the forum for Tasks/Notes on Android
7. does already exist
8. no, this is not the sense of MyPhoneExplorer, btw i don't like Facebook
9. you can already monitor the health state of your phone
DBCS-Support. I know this is a big problem but i did not find a way to fix it |

Nokia Ovi Suite allows messages from any Nokia phone to be saved in it. One can import and export messages in csv format not vmg.
In MPE one can export messages in Excel format but there is no option to import messages.
I have exported messages from MPE and imported into Ovi suite after converting it to csv format. Next from Ovi suite transferred into a Nokia phone.
Hope this can be available for MPE in the future and there will be no need to have archive folder because all the messages are saved in MPE and any message can be transferred to a compatible phone. Messages can be exported or imported without any problem.
